At Quantcast, we\’re redefining what\’s possible in digital advertising. As a global Demand Side Platform (DSP) powered by AI, we help marketers connect with the right audiences and deliver measurable results across the Open Web. Our foundation is built on cutting‐edge measurement and consumer analytics, giving our clients the tools they need to drive success in an ever‐evolving digital landscape.Since our start in 2006, we\’ve pioneered industry firsts—from launching the original measurement platform for digital publishers to introducing the first AI‐driven DSP. If you\’re ready to be part of a dynamic, forward‐thinking team that thrives on creating transformative solutions, Quantcast is the perfect place to grow your career.We are seeking a Senior Sales Enablement Manager to join our Marketing team and work closely with revenue leadership and our commercial teams.This role is crucial in equipping our customer‐facing teams with the tools, training, and resources they need to successfully drive revenue growth in a rapidly evolving ad‐tech landscape. A proactive approach to communication, project management, and strategic thinking is essential for this role, along with the ability to partner successfully with cross‐functional, global teams.What you\’ll do: Develop and execute revenue enablement programs related to onboarding, skill development, industry knowledge, and ongoing education to enhance sales effectiveness and revenue generation.Create and deliver training content in multiple formats to educate customer‐facing teams on Quantcast\’s solutions, digital advertising trends, programmatic platforms, measurement & analytics, and sales strategies.Collaborate with Sales, Marketing, Product, and Customer Success teams to align messaging, sales strategies, and go‐to‐market initiatives.Equip sales teams with effective content, playbooks, and competitive intelligence to navigate a rapidly evolving adtech landscape.Analyze key performance metrics to measure the impact of enablement programs relative to the company\’s larger business goals and identify areas for improvement.Facilitate communication between sales teams and cross‐functional stakeholders, ensuring a seamless knowledge‐sharing environment.Stay ahead of industry trends that impact digital advertising, providing guidance on how they influence sales strategies.Who you are: Minimum of 5 years Sales Enablement experience in adtech and/or media sales, SaaS, or technology industries.Ability to understand and respond to the challenges of GTM teams.Familiarity with C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ot) and sales enablement platforms.Knowledge of sales methodologies (e.g., MEDDIC, SPIN Selling, Challenger).Experience using learning management systems (LMS) for training delivery.Quantcast operates in a hybrid work environment.
